Is Wolf the same as Sub-Zero?
They are sister brands under the same parent company, but they cover different appliances. Wolf is the cooking side — ranges, rangetops, cooktops, wall ovens, steam ovens, microwaves, and warming drawers. Sub-Zero is the refrigeration side. My Wolf range runs on propane and won't hold a simmer. Can you fix that?
Yes, this is a common foothill call. A Wolf burner converted to LP that was never fully tuned will run fine on high but lift or blow out on the low setting. We check the manifold pressure, confirm the correct LP orifices are installed, and adjust the burner so the simmer ring holds a steady low flame instead of fighting you.
Why does my Wolf oven read the wrong temperature?
Most often the RTD temperature sensor has drifted. Wolf ovens read the cavity through that resistance probe, and as it ages its reading wanders, so the oven over- or under-shoots the dial. We meter the sensor against its spec curve, replace it if it has drifted, and recalibrate so the cavity holds the temperature you set.
Do you handle both gas and dual-fuel Wolf units?
Yes. We work all-gas GR ranges, dual-fuel DF ranges, SRT rangetops, CG gas cooktops, and CI induction surfaces. That covers ignition and burner tuning on the gas side, the inverter and cooling system on induction, and the convection oven cavity on each.
